Subject: DR drill — Lintbury component library

Hi,

As part of Thursday's disaster-recovery drill, we'll restore the Lintbury shared component library registry from cold backup and verify that semver history (including yanked 3.x releases) reconstructs correctly. Security review point: the restore host runs isolated, and publish tokens stay revoked until checksums match the manifest. Consumers pin to minor versions, so any gap in 3.4.x would break downstream builds. The restore vault unlocks with the recovery passphrase below.

vault phrase of bagaf-kajeg = jorath-feniel-briir-siliel-ralix

## Handover — Validator Plugin System

Welcome aboard. The Copperline validator framework loads plugins from the registry at startup; each plugin must pass the conformance suite before promotion. Avoid editing the core dispatch table directly — use the extension hooks documented in the Thistledown wiki. Known issue: the date-range validator double-fires on leap years; a patch is pending review. All plugin promotions and emergency disables must be cleared with the person named below.

signatory, yagap-bawig: Ulaath Eliath

Diligence 70% complete. Tech stack solid; their Wrenfield office lease is the main liability. Integration lead named internally — announcement pending. Budget freeze on overlapping tooling purchases effective now. No external hires in analytics until close or kill decision, expected within six weeks. Questions route through planning office only; do not brief your teams. Timeline and pricing remain tightly held. The restricted note on our intentions is recorded below.

board note of bawep-tajef: Queniusek Systems plans to raise the Quenvan list price by 53.1 percent in March. The pricing group signed off on a budget of $176.4 million for Project Drueth. The renewal with Casionix Partners closes at $142.5 million a year, 8.3 percent below the last contract. Project Fraax slips by six weeks because of the tooling delay.

## Migration step 4: Regenerate the baseline

Before enabling Grindstone's strict mode, delete the old baseline file and regenerate it against the current branch head. Stale baselines suppress new findings and will fail the gate check. Run the regeneration task once per repo, then commit. The generator expects these settings to be present:

deployment values, fahap-hahaf:
[casdor]
port = 9200
region = south-2
host = casdor.qirvanworks.corp
timeout_ms = 3000
retries = 4